Hello Java Lucene dev's, I'm pretty much a newbie when it comes to Lucene. Actually I have a query. I am using Lucene for indexing logs, so as to make the searching of logs effective. No doubt, it is working hassle free, but here is something where I am stuck since days. I want to sort these logs date wise, the latest being the first in the result(descending order). For this, I have added a datetime field during indexing in the document. Something like this: long dateTime = DateUtil.getTime(logObject.getDate(),logObject.getTime(),"dd.MM.yyyy HH:mm:ss:S"); document.add(new LongField("datetime",dateTime,Field.Store.YES)); --- Now while searching, I am adding these lines: TopDocs result = null; ----code here---- Sort sort = new Sort(new SortField("datetime", SortField.Type.LONG)); result = searcher.search(query,recCountToFetch,sort); I wished it would work fine, but then I a came across this error: javax.xml.ws.soap.SOAPFaultException: java.lang.Exception: java.lang.IllegalStateException: unexpected docvalues type NONE for field 'datetime' (expected=NUMERIC). Use UninvertingReader or index with docvalues.
